The question

What is the vow that must be devoted solely to God? And does it include a person saying to another living person: "If such and such happens, I will pay you so and so?"

The answer

A vow () is an act of worship, and directing it to other than Allah is polytheism (). It is forbidden to make vows for the living or the dead to gain benefit or avert harm, because that is shirk. As for a person's statement, "I will pay you such-and-such if such-and-such happens," this is a promise for which fulfillment is sought, but it is not binding unless the promisee incurs trouble because of it.
